Buying Guide for the Best Smart Locks For Airbnb
Choosing a smart lock for an Airbnb property can make hosting much easier and more convenient. The right smart lock lets you provide keyless entry for your guests, enhance security, and reduce hassle over physical keys. As you compare options, focus on how easy the lock is to manage remotely, how robust the security features are, and how well it fits with your door and existing systems. Think about the experience you want for both yourself and your guests: simple, secure, and stress-free.Remote Access and ControlRemote access means you can control the lock from anywhere using your smartphone or computer. This spec is crucial for Airbnb hosts who need to grant or revoke access without being physically present. Some locks offer simple app controls, others allow integration with smart home hubs or Airbnb platforms. Locks with robust remote controls let you create temporary codes or unlock the door on-demand. If you manage the property from afar or have frequent guests, strong remote capabilities are essential. If you or a co-host are always nearby, this may be less critical—but still a helpful safety net.
Guest Code ManagementSmart locks often let you generate unique codes for each guest. This feature is important for security and convenience because you don’t need to hand over (or recover) physical keys. Some basic locks allow only a few codes at a time; advanced models offer dozens or even hundreds, with the ability to schedule when they become active or expire. For busy Airbnb rentals with frequent guest turnover, look for a lock with robust code management that automates timed access and keeps things organized.
Security FeaturesSecurity is everything in a rental property. Good smart locks offer features like auto-locking, alarm triggers, tamper alerts, and advanced encryption for digital communications. Simple models may only lock/unlock with a code, while higher-end versions detect forced entry attempts or alert you to suspicious activity. Consider what level of security your property and neighborhood demand—each added feature boosts peace of mind for both you and your guests.
Installation and CompatibilityNot all smart locks fit every door. Some are designed for deadbolts, others for handles or mortise locks. Also consider whether it needs to replace the whole existing lock or just add on to it, which will affect ease of installation and cost. If you want to avoid hiring a locksmith, look for models designed for ‘DIY’ installation. Always check that the lock’s design and size match your door’s thickness and style.
Power Source and Battery LifeMost smart locks run on batteries, so it’s important to know how long they last and how the lock alerts you when power is low. Shorter-life batteries need more frequent attention and risk going dead at a bad time. Basic locks may last a few months per set, while advanced ones can stretch a year or more. If you don’t visit the property often, longer battery life and strong low-battery alerts are a must. Some locks feature emergency ways to open if power runs out—another important safety consideration.
Integration with Airbnb and Other PlatformsIf you want your smart lock to work seamlessly with your Airbnb hosting dashboard, check for direct integration options. Some locks can automatically send codes to guests when you confirm a booking, simplifying check-in processes. Others may work with platforms like Google Home, Alexa, or property management tools. If automation and hassle-free communication are priorities, prioritize locks that easily connect to the systems you use.
